Performance of the D5000 and High Sensitivity D5000 ScreenTape Assays The Agilent D5000 ScreenTape and High Sensitivity D5000 ScreenTape assays have been developed for the analysis of DNA fragments (100 bp to 5,000 bp) within the Next Generation Sequencing (NGS) workflow 5067-5592 High Sensitivity D5000 ScreenTape 7 ScreenTape devices 5067-5593 High Sensitivity D5000 Reagents • High Sensitivity D5000 Ladder • High Sensitivity D5000 Sample Buffer 2 vials 20µL 300µL 5067-5594 High Sensitivity D5000 Ladder 1 vial, 20µL WARNING Toxic agents Refer to product material safety datasheets for further information.
